New Online Tools Reduce Wait Times for Callers
The USCIS Contact Center is currently experiencing higher than normal wait times for callers to speak to a representative. While we work to resolve this, we encourage you to use our online tools.
The USCIS Contact Center is changing its hours of operation to ensure that we have the maximum number of representatives available during the busiest times of day.
Representatives are available from 8 a.m. to 8 p.m. Eastern, Monday ? Friday (excluding federal holidays).

Concurrently filed i485, i765, i130, i131 sent to Chicago Lockbox. Received on 27 September 2018. Field Office is Las Vegas, NV. They sent out receipt letters and scheduled the bio appointment in October. They cashed the check 2 October 2018. The website was updated to that point. That's the last update I have. We went to the Bio appointment on 29 October 2018. The appointment was for 2pm, we showed up at 1pm and were out by 1:30pm. I thought the process was going to be way easier than what I've heard. Come mid February and we receive the i693 Courtesy Letter dated 7 February 2019. So we've heard nothing else since 2 October, but at least now I know somebody has looked at our case.
